Chase Docklands is known in the community for serving halal food and is listed on popular halal directories. While they don't have a formal certificate on display, their entire food menu is pork-free, featuring beef, lamb, and chicken, which is a great sign for Muslim diners.
They do not serve any pork at all. However, the restaurant is fully licensed and has an extensive menu of alcoholic drinks, including cocktails, wine, and beer.
We couldn't find any specific information about their meat being hand-slaughtered (zabihah). For specific details on their meat supplier, it's always best to ask the staff directly when you visit.
There isn't a prayer room inside the restaurant itself, but the multi-faith prayer room at Southern Cross Station is about an 800-meter walk away, which is convenient if you're in the area.
Yes, they are great for groups and celebrations! They offer private dining and can host events like birthday parties and company functions in their beautiful waterfront setting.

We're very confident in this rating. The restaurant is listed as serving halal food on well-known directories and the community also reports it as a place with a halal menu. Their menu is entirely pork-free, which supports their claims. They do serve alcohol, which is why we've classified them as 'Halal Friendly'.
